How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Marcola?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Marcola Studio Apartments | $1,516 | $1,000 | $1,741 |
| Marcola 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,680 | $1,065 | $2,869 |
Marcola 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,825 | $925 | $3,370 |
| Marcola 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,252 | $619 | $3,845 |
| Marcola 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,243 | $679 | $3,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Marcola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Marcola with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Marcola is at PARKGROVE APARTMENTS listed at $1,249.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Marcola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Marcola is $1,825.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Marcola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Marcola is a 1,190 square feet unit starting from $2,259 at Evergreen Village at Delta Ridge.
What is the average size for Marcola 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Marcola is currently 1,005 sq ft.
